Introduction to Coinbase’s Pre-Launch Markets

In a groundbreaking move, cryptocurrency giant Coinbase has unveiled pre-launch markets, a novel trading feature that allows users to engage in speculative trading of tokens before they are officially released. This platform enables traders to speculate on the future value of these tokens through perpetual futures contracts, which transition into standard perpetual futures once the actual tokens go live on a recognized exchange.

Mechanics and Implications of Pre-Launch Markets

Coinbase’s pre-launch markets are distinguished by their unique approach to price discovery. Traders can invest in these markets to gauge the potential success of new cryptocurrency projects ahead of their market debut. This mechanism, however, also introduces heightened volatility and the risk of manipulation. Unlike standard perpetual futures, pre-launch markets use an alternative index price mechanism, which can lead to significant price swings. Furthermore, there is always a risk that the underlying token might never be released, which could result in market suspension or delisting, consequently leading to potential financial losses for traders.

Risk Management and User Safeguards

Coinbase has taken several precautionary measures to manage the intrinsic risks associated with pre-launch markets. These measures include imposing strict leverage limits (maximum of 2x) and capping position sizes at $50,000. The exchange also employs an isolated margin mode specifically for these markets to contain potential losses. These steps are designed to protect investors from the severe market volatility and potential financial fallout linked to these speculative trades.

Regulatory Constraints and Market Access

At present, Coinbase’s pre-launch markets are not available to traders in the United States, United Kingdom, and Canada, reflecting regulatory constraints within these jurisdictions. Community Reactions and Market Outlook

The crypto community has responded with a mixture of enthusiasm and skepticism to Coinbase’s latest offering. While some view the pre-launch markets as an exciting opportunity to gain early exposure to promising blockchain projects, others express concerns over the volatility and speculative nature of these investments. Industry analysts are closely monitoring the performance of these markets, suggesting that their future success will hinge on how effectively Coinbase can manage the associated risks and deliver on its promise of a secure trading environment.
